Key Raw Materials for Ferric Phosphate Gummies

1. Ferric Phosphate (Iron Source)
Ferric phosphate is a well-tolerated iron supplement that minimizes gastrointestinal side effects. High-purity ferric phosphate ensures optimal bioavailability and stability in gummy formulations.

2. Gelatin or Pectin (Gelling Agents)
– Gelatin: Provides a chewy texture and is ideal for traditional gummies.
– Pectin: A plant-based alternative for vegan or vegetarian products.

3. Sweeteners (Sugar, Glucose Syrup, or Natural Alternatives)
Balancing sweetness while maintaining texture is essential. Natural sweeteners like stevia or monk fruit extract can be used for sugar-free options.

4. Flavors & Colors
Natural fruit extracts and plant-based colors enhance taste and appeal without artificial additives.

5. Acidulants (Citric Acid, Malic Acid)
Improves flavor and extends shelf life by maintaining pH balance.

6. Preservatives (Natural Options Preferred)
Potassium sorbate or rosemary extract helps prolong freshness while meeting clean-label demands.
